Summary, etc. Rice is greatly established in the Filipino cuisine and culture. It plays a big role in our every meal as it is the most important food crop, a staple food in most parts of the country. It has been recorded that half the country's population subsists wholly or partially on rice. Unfortunately, the supply of rice in the country is still insufficient to accommodate its demand though many farmers around the Philippines produce rice farms. The rapid increase in population growth that results to higher demand rate; the urbanization and land conversion that transforms farmlands into various developments; the long farm to market roads that contribute to less efficiency rate of rice production; and the old irrigation systems are the main reasons for the low rice production in the country.
